The Contested Default and Mediation Manager’s primary responsibility will be the monitoring and management of the Mediation and Case Specialists. Will review industry standards and coordinate with senior management in creating and maintaining processes and procedures for non-jury trial litigation and contested foreclosure matters. Will act as a liaison for the attorney, lines of business and/or investor in the resolution of the aforementioned matters. In addition to the management of contested matters, the Manager will have oversight of all meditation activity on default files. It will be the Manager’s responsibility to ensure a timely resolution to all mediation matters while complying with investor/insurer guidelines.
